Position Overview

We are seeking an experienced Construction Superintendent to lead field operations for a high-profile hospitality project in Naples, Florida. This role requires a technically proficient field leader with strong MEP coordination capabilities, post-tension (PT) slab knowledge, and the ability to manage schedule, inspections, subcontractors, and ownership interface in a fast-paced environment.

The Superintendent will be responsible for day-to-day site supervision, quality control, schedule enforcement, and coordination between ownership, brand representatives, consultants, and trade partners.

Key Responsibilities

Field Operations & Technical Oversight

  • Manage daily on-site construction activities and subcontractor coordination.
  • Oversee installation and coordination of MEP systems (mechanical, electrical, plumbing) to ensure compliance with contract documents and sequencing requirements.
  • Supervise and inspect post-tension (PT) structural slab operations, including tendon placement, stressing operations, and inspection coordination.
  • Enforce quality control standards and ensure work conforms to drawings, specifications, and brand standards.
  • Operate site equipment as needed, including skid steer and forklift.

Scheduling & Project Controls

  • Develop, update, and enforce project schedules using Microsoft Project.
  • Coordinate short-interval planning with trade contractors.
  • Identify critical path impacts and proactively mitigate schedule delays.
  • Utilize Autodesk Construction Cloud and Bluebeam Revu for document control, submittal review support, field coordination, and markups.

Inspections & Compliance

  • Schedule and coordinate all required inspections with:
  • Authority Having Jurisdiction (AHJ)
  • Third-party/special inspectors (Threshold inspections)
  • Materials testing
  • Maintain a comprehensive inspection log.
  • Track and manage correction notices and ensure timely resolution.

Quality Control & Closeout

  • Create, manage, and maintain a deficiencies (punch) log.
  • Drive subcontractors toward timely correction of deficiencies.
  • Coordinate phased turnover inspections and final inspections.

Communication & Stakeholder Management

  • Serve as primary field liaison between
  • Ownership
  • Brand representatives
  • Design team
  • Subcontractors
  • Conduct coordination meetings and communicate schedule expectations clearly.
  • Provide consistent field reporting and status updates.
